The part, "(Walckenaer, 1837)," means that this tarantula was originally described and named by a man, Baron Charles Athanase Walckenaer, in 1837. Mature females will have a body length of up to about 7.5 centimeters (three inches) and a leg span of about fifteen centimeters (six inches). Chilean roses have only been imported in any numbers since the early 1990s following the fall of the Chilean dictator Augusto Pinochet Ugarte in March 1990. Further, for about a decade there have been repeated rumors, especially from European enthusiasts, that someone had examined specimens in the pet industry and those in museums, and determined that what is now considered one species (Grammostola rosea) really was several different species. It has been noted by several people that the pink and red color forms of the Chilean rose do not seem to blend in with the background soil, or function as camouflage. While one sees many baby Chilean roses listed on the dealer's price list as "captive bred," the truth is that most such babies are the result of wild caught females producing eggsacs once they are imported. One color form is a more or less uniform, drab, dark gray (sometimes called "muddy" or "grubby") with at most only a sprinkling of lighter beige or pinkish hairs. You can try to hatch them, but this condition is almost always terminal. $25.00. However, recently Dr. G. B. Edwards (Curator: Arachnida & Myriapoda Florida State Collection of Arthropods, FDACS, Division of Plant Industry), while on a trip to Santiago Chile, examined Chilean rose tarantulas in large numbers living in burrows some 45 centimeters (18 inches) deep. In their native Chile summer temperatures commonly go above 100° F (38° C), and winter temperatures often drop below freezing towards early morning. However, on several occasions all of the several color forms were reported to arise from the same eggsac, strong evidence that these are all merely variants of the same species. As an educated guess we can bracket the probable limits of their life spans at five to ten years for males, and twenty to twenty-five years for females. Well fed Chilean roses can go easily for up to two years without starving to death once they go on one of these little fasts.
